2010-08-19 3 views
3

Когда мы пытаемся сохранить файл документа msword как файл html, мы получаем файлы «wmz» для объектов математического уравнения.Файл декомпрессии «wmz»

Я попытался распаковать файл wmz и сохранить содержимое как jpg.

Я могу открыть этот файл jpg в «Microsoft Picture Manager» правильно. Но при попытке открыть файл в браузере отображается сообщение об ошибке «Изображение не может быть отображено, потому что оно содержит ошибки».

Какова процедура распаковки этого файла wmz и преобразования его в jpg. Каким будет расширение распакованного файла?

+2

В этом «вопросе» есть «много» «двойных кавычек»! – Timwi

+0

Я распаковал файл wmz в файл wmf и смог сохранить файл wmf в файле bmp и получить цвет в пикселе (0,0) и установить этот цвет как прозрачный цвет изображения. Но вместо изображения я вижу только черный цвет. Как изменить прозрачный цвет изображения? –

ответ

3

Когда вы сохраняете документы Word как «веб-страницу, отфильтрованы», вы не получите эти WMZ-файлы, а только файлы PNG. Установите для параметра «Веб-параметры» значение для низкой версии IE (например, 4.0) и установите флажок «Разрешить файлы PNG» и «отключить функции, не поддерживаемые этими браузерами». Добавленное преимущество заключается в том, что веб-страница будет отображаться лучше в разных браузерах.

Однако вы должны сделать все это после того, как вы сначала сделаете копию своего документа (и связанных файлов) с помощью проводника в другое место. Откройте эту копию с помощью Word, а затем сохраните как «Веб-страницу, отфильтрованный». Оригинал, который вы храните для редактирования. (Не сохраняйте оригинал как «веб-страницу, отфильтрован» или вы потеряете способность редактировать объекты уравнения).

+0

+1. Хороший ответ. –

+0

Спасибо, но я копирую содержимое в буфер обмена и обрабатываю изображения во временном местоположении и перемещаю их в постоянное место и сохраняю содержимое буфера обмена как html. Это я не могу правильно обрабатывать файлы wmz. –

4

.WMZ похоже на молнию. WMF файл.

Вы можете открыть распакованный файл с изображением/редактором (просто попробуйте IrfanView) и сохранить как .jpg.

+0

FYI: XnView дает мне лучшие результаты при визуализации файлов .wmz, чем IrfanView. – Martijn

1

Спасибо за помощь. Наконец-то я не смог удалить черный фон из файла изображения. Итак, используя круглый подход на данный момент

1) Декомпрессируйте файл wmz в массив байтов (wmf).

2) Открыт новое слово документ

3) Вставить массив байт в слове документ. (Этот документ должен содержать только эти данные, и никакой другой дополнительной информации)

4) Сохраните документ как HTML-файл (WdSaveFormat.wdFormatFilteredHTML)

5) открыть "_FILES" каталог, созданный для HTML вывода

6) Найти единственный файл "GIF", созданный в директории

Смежные вопросы